Yokogawa SGD7S-200A00B2
Product Type: Compact AC Servo Drive / Amplifier
Product Introduction:
The SGD7S-200A00B2 is a compact, economical servo drive from Yokogawa’s Sigma-7 product line. It is designed for single-axis servo motor control in applications requiring space-saving installation. The model code represents a specific power rating and configuration.

Model Code Breakdown:
- SGD7S — Sigma-7 Compact Servo Drive
- 200 — Rated output power: 200W (0.2 kW)
- A — Input power: 100–120 VAC (single-phase)
- 00 — No built-in braking resistor, no built-in EMC filter
- B2 — Control power: 24 VDC input, with specific I/O configuration (B2 variant)
Technical Specifications:
| Parameter | Value |
|---|---|
| Rated Output Power | 200 W (0.2 kW) |
| Input Voltage | 100–120 VAC, single-phase, 50/60 Hz |
| Continuous Output Current | Approximately 1.4 A (RMS) |
| Peak Output Current | Approximately 4.2 A (3 seconds) |
| Control Mode | Position / Speed / Torque |
| Communication Protocol | MECHATROLINK-III, RS-422 (Modbus RTU optional) |
| Control Power | 24 VDC (supplied externally) |
| Encoder Input | Incremental encoder (A/B/Z phase, 2500 ppr max), Open-collector output compatible |
| Safety Function | Safe Torque Off (STO), Safe Stop 1 |
| Operating Temperature | 0°C to +40°C (derating above +35°C) |
| Enclosure Rating | IP20 |
| Dimensions (W x H x D) | Approximately 65 x 98 x 130 mm |
| Weight | Approximately 0.8 kg |
| Braking Resistor | External (not built-in) |
| EMC Filter | External (not built-in) |
Functional Features:
- Compact footprint: One of the smallest servo drives in the Sigma-7 family
- Auto-tuning for servo motor parameter optimization
- Electronic gear ratio: 1/10 to 10000/1
- Built-in positioning controller: Up to 4-axis interpolation (when used with SGD7S master)
- Flexible I/O: 6 digital inputs, 2 digital outputs (configurable)
- STO (Safe Torque Off): IEC 61800-5-2 compliant safety function
- One-touch auto-tuning via front-panel button or software
Structural Features:
- Ultra-compact DIN-rail or panel-mountable housing
- Screw-terminal connections for power, motor, encoder, and I/O
- LED status indicators: Power, Ready, Alarm, Active
- Front-panel 7-segment display for parameter monitoring

Installation Requirements:
- Mount with ≥ 50 mm clearance on all sides for ventilation
- Use external braking resistor rated for 200W servo systems (for vertical axis or high-inertia loads)
- Install external EMC filter per local EMC regulations
- Connect 24 VDC control power before applying main power
- Ground the chassis to earth ground (≤ 100 Ω)
Usage Precautions:
- Do not operate without an external braking resistor for vertical-axis or high-inertia applications
- Verify encoder signal compatibility: 5V differential line driver (RS-422A) or open-collector (5–24 VDC)
- Perform auto-tuning after any motor replacement or mechanical change
- Do not exceed the peak current rating for more than 3 seconds
- Derate output power by 1% per °C above +35°C ambient temperature
